The referee was I. Tantashev, with 100 matches in our database and 1.1 yellows per game on average. Jassim Bin Hamad Stadium staged the fixture, a ground that holds 20,000. On the scoreboard, it was 0-0 at the break; 3 second-half goals set the final 2-1.
Goal scorers
Qatar: Boualem Khoukhi (49'), Pedro Miguel (74') · United Arab Emirates: Sultan Adil (90')
